Though it was about time to put some pics of my car up at last , haven't got time for a project thread.
Since u bought the car standard in January I have done the following
Storm grey cyclones
Phase 1 half leathers
Gti6 disc beam
266mm s16 brakes
grooved discs and greenstuff all round
Adjustable spax psx krypton has suspension
Bosch pump with ground lda
fmic setup
Phase 3 tailgate and lights
semi straight through exhaust
Running 20psi roughly matched fuelling.
Prob a few other bits I've missed
